Spalding to Pinchbeck Active Travel Improvements

The Spalding to Pinchbeck Active Travel improvement project will include:

  • increasing the accessibility and safety of sustainable travel in Spalding and Pinchbeck 
  • creating a mixture of segregated and shared cycleways and footways between the two 

Aims and benefits

  • increasing opportunities for people to travel by walking, wheeling, and cycling
  • improving safety for pedestrians and cyclists
  • supporting the health and wellbeing of Spalding and Pinchbeck residents
  • enhancing Lincolnshire’s walking and cycling network
  • reducing carbon emissions by encouraging more people to travel by walking, wheeling, and cycling

Cost and funding

The project is expected to cost £1.8m and will be funded by Active Travel England’s ‘Tranche 3 Active Travel Fund’, which was awarded to Lincolnshire County Council in May 2022.
